Understanding Predictive Maintenance
What is Predictive Maintenance?
Predictive maintenance involves using technology to monitor the condition of home systems and appliances. It anticipates potential malfunctions and allows you to fix them before they result in costly repairs. This concept is similar to preventive maintenance but is more data-driven and predictive.
How Does It Work?
This approach uses sensors and smart devices connected through an IoT network to track the performance of essential home systems. If irregularities are detected, these systems send notifications to alert the homeowner about potential issues.

Key Systems for Predictive Maintenance
HVAC Systems
Heating, ventilation, and air conditioning systems are critical components of home comfort. Predictive maintenance monitors these systems for irregularities, ensuring optimal performance and energy efficiency.
Plumbing Systems
Early detection of leaks and other plumbing issues can prevent water waste and avoid potential water damage, saving homeowners money and preserving environmental resources.
Electrical Systems
Monitoring electrical systems can prevent overloads and detect faulty components, reducing the risk of fires and electrical failures while ensuring efficient energy use.
